Small Batch Baked Chocolate Glazed Donuts

Prep Time 20 minutes
Cook Time 10 minutes
Servings: 6
Course: Dessert

Ingredients
  

For the donuts:
  • 3/4 cup all-purpose flour
  • 1/4 cup cocoa powder
  • 1/4 cup sugar
  • 1 tsp baking powder
  • 1/4 tsp salt
  • 1/4 cup plain Greek yogurt
  • 1/4 cup milk
  • 2 tbsp vegetable oil
  • 1 tsp vanilla
  • 1/4 tsp espresso powder (optional)
For the glaze:
  • 1/2 cup semi-sweet chocolate chips
  • 2 tbsp milk
  • chocolate sprinkles optional

Method
 

  1. Preheat oven to 400 degrees F. Grease a 6-slot donut pan with nonstick cooking spray and set aside.
  2. In a medium sized bowl, mix together dry ingredients, including flour, cocoa powder, baking powder, espresso powder, and salt, along with your sugar.
  3. In a small bowl or glass measuring cup, mix together your wet ingredients: milk, egg (beaten), yogurt, oil, and vanilla.
  4. Pour your wet ingredients into the flour mixture, stirring just until combined and mixture is smooth.
  5. Spoon or pipe your donut batter into your donut pan--I typically use a spoon and even out the batter with my finger, but using a piping bag is much neater.
  6. Bake your donuts for 9-11 minutes. You'll be able to tell that they're done when you can press your finger into a donut and it springs back without leaving an indentation.
  7. After letting the donuts cool for a bit, make your glaze: melt chocolate chips in a microwave safe bowl, microwaving for 30 second intervals and stirring in between. Add in your milk and stir until smooth.
  8. Carefully dip the tops of donuts in the glaze, top with chocolate sprinkles, then let cool again and enjoy!

Notes

Yields 6 donuts. Works for high altitude or normal altitude--no adjustments needed.
If you want to make a regular batch (not small batch), simply double the ingredient quantities!
